2nd Place Jim Stevens, 3rd Place Barry Souders, Winner Eric King. Golden Shaft presented by Sara Simmons


Congratulations to the 2019 Buckeye Cub Tug Winner Eric King of Amelia, Ohio. The win was especially meaningful to Eric as it was on the tractor that his friend Mike Jones owned. The family gave the tractor to Eric after Mike’s passing last year. Second place went to Jim Stevens and third place to Barry Souders.

Bonnie and I want to thank everyone for making the 2019 Buckeye Cub Tug successful. I hope everyone enjoyed themselves as much as we did. For those who didn’t attend the drivers meeting on Saturday, we dedicated this year’s Cub Tug to Ralph Napier. Our thoughts and prayers go out to Ralph for a full and speedy recovery.

This year there were people representing 10 states: New York, Pennsylvania, Maryland, Indiana, Illinois, Tennessee, Colorado, Florida, Louisiana, and of course, the Buckeye State, Ohio.
